Understanding Your Audience | The Key to Effective Content Marketing
Before we type a single word, we must define exactly who we are speaking to. In the realm of content marketing, audience persona development is not just a preliminary step; it is the foundation of every successful campaign. We start by identifying the pain points, goals, and demographic profiles of the ideal customer.
For a digital marketing company, this often means speaking directly to decision-makers who are frustrated by stagnant growth or a lack of online visibility. We must ask ourselves what keeps these individuals up at night. Are they worried about their ROI? Are they struggling to keep up with competitors? By answering these questions, we can tailor our messaging to provide the exact solutions they are searching for.
The buyer’s journey is rarely a straight line. It is a multi-stage process that begins with awareness, moves through consideration, and ends in a decision. At the awareness stage, our content writing should focus on educational topics that help the user identify their problem. As they move into the consideration phase, we provide more detailed comparisons and case studies.
Finally, at the decision stage, we offer clear proof of our expertise and a direct path to purchase. This nuanced approach ensures that we are providing the right information at the right time, building trust and authority every step of the way.
It is also important to remember that different segments of an audience may use different terminology. This is where keyword research becomes invaluable. We use tools to identify the specific phrases and questions our audience uses when they search for services.
By integrating these terms naturally into our narrative, we demonstrate that we speak their language and understand their specific needs. This alignment between user intent and our messaging is what separates average websites from industry leaders.
How to Write Web Content | Balancing Creativity and Technical Precision
Writing for the web is a specialized skill that differs significantly from print journalism or academic writing. When we execute web content writing, we must prioritize clarity and scannability. Most users do not read every word on a page; they scan for headers, bullet points, and bolded text.
To accommodate this behavior, we structure our posts with a clear hierarchy. We use descriptive headers that tell the story of the page on their own. This not only helps the human reader find what they need quickly but also provides the search bots with a clear map of our topic.
The technical side of web content writing involves the strategic placement of keywords. We focus on a primary keyword while supporting it with secondary and long-tail variations. This helps search engines understand the context of our page without resorting to keyword stuffing, which can lead to penalties.
We also pay close attention to internal and external linking. By linking to other relevant pages on our site, we keep users engaged longer and help bots crawl our site more effectively. External links to authoritative sources further enhance our credibility and provide additional value to the reader.
Storytelling is another critical component of effective web writing. We don’t just list features; we tell stories about how those features solve real-world problems. For example, instead of saying we offer SEO services, we might share a narrative about a local business that was struggling to find customers until they optimized their digital presence. This human element makes the information more relatable and memorable. It transforms a dry service description into a compelling reason to choose our team over anyone else.
Common Content Writing Mistakes | What to Avoid for Better SEO
Even the most experienced teams can fall into common traps that hinder their performance. One of the most frequent errors we see is a lack of focus. When a page tries to cover too many topics at once, it confuses both the reader and the search engine.
We recommend sticking to one primary theme per page, supported by related subtopics. This ensures that the page remains highly relevant for specific search queries. Another common mistake is ignoring the mobile experience. Since a vast majority of web traffic now comes from mobile devices, we must ensure our text is easy to read on small screens, with shorter paragraphs and plenty of white space.
Another pitfall is failing to update old material. The digital world moves fast, and information that was accurate a year ago may be outdated today. We make it a practice to regularly review and refresh our existing pages to maintain their relevance and rankings. This includes checking for broken links, updating statistics, and refining the language to reflect current industry trends. Neglecting this maintenance can lead to a gradual decline in traffic as newer, more relevant content from others begins to outrank ours.
Lastly, we must be careful not to write solely for the search engines. While SEO is vital, the ultimate goal is to convert human visitors. If our text is clunky, repetitive, or lacks a clear voice, users will bounce from the page regardless of how high it ranks. We strive for a natural, conversational tone that reflects our brand’s personality. By putting the user’s needs first, we naturally satisfy the requirements of search engines, as they are increasingly designed to reward high-quality, user-focused material.

Step-by-Step Guide to Optimizing Your Blog Posts
-
Thorough Keyword Research
Use tools like SEMrush, Ahrefs, or Google Keyword Planner to find terms with high search volume and low competition. Focus on your primary focus keyword and identify several secondary terms to include naturally.
-
Structure with Headers
Organize your thoughts into logical sections using H2 and H3 headers. Ensure each header contains at least one of your target phrases to help search engines understand the structure of your page.
-
Write for Scannability
Keep your paragraphs short (3-4 sentences maximum). Use bulleted lists, numbered steps, and bold text to highlight key points. This makes the information more accessible to browsers who are in a hurry.
-
Include Internal and External Links
Link to at least 2-3 other pages on your own website to keep users engaged. Also, include 1-2 links to high-authority external sites to provide additional context and boost your credibility.
-
Optimize Your Metadata
Write a compelling meta title and description that includes your primary keyword. This is what users see in search results, so make it enticing enough to encourage clicks.
-
Add a Clear Call to Action
Tell your readers exactly what you want them to do next. Whether it’s signing up for a newsletter, downloading a whitepaper, or contacting you for a consultation, the next step should be obvious.
-
Proofread and Edit
Before hitting publish, review your work for grammar, spelling, and tone. Ensure that your keywords are integrated naturally and that the piece flows logically from beginning to end.

Q. What is the difference between content writing and content marketing?
Content writing refers to the actual process of creating text, such as blog posts, articles, and web pages. Content marketing is the broader strategy of using that text, along with other media, to attract, engage, and retain an audience with the ultimate goal of driving profitable customer action.

Q. How often should I update my website’s content?
We recommend reviewing your top-performing pages at least once every six months. This allows you to update statistics, refresh the language, and ensure that all links are still active. Regularly adding new blog posts is also vital for signaling to search engine bots that your site is active and relevant.
Q. What is web content writing?
Web content writing is the specific practice of creating text for websites. It requires a balance of engaging storytelling for human readers and technical optimization (SEO) for search engine bots to ensure the page is both readable and discoverable.
